How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 10454?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
10454 Studio Apartments | $2,695 | $2,659 | $2,732 |
10454 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,683 | $1,600 | $1,800 |
10454 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,333 | $1,900 | $2,650 |
10454 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,654 | $2,200 | $2,999 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Loft the 10454 ZIP Code Apartments
How much is the average rent for a Loft 10454 Apartment?
The average rent for a Loft Apartment in 10454 is $1,812.
What is the largest Loft 10454 Apartment for rent?
Today's Loft apartment with the most square footage in 10454 is a 1,345 square feet unit starting from $1,325 at The School House.
What is the average size for 10454 Loft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Loft rental in 10454 is currently at 563 sq ft.
